Local festivals of Valdés

Valdés concentrates several notable celebrations in Luarca, Cadavedo and other towns in the council. The best-known festive references are the festivities of San Timoteo in Luarca, the seafaring celebration of Nuestra Señora del Rosario y La Regalina en Cadavedo.

  • Name of the municipality's festivities: San Timoteo in Luarca, Nuestra Señora del Rosario in Luarca and La Regalina in Cadavedo, along with other parish celebrations in the council.
  • Main celebration day: 22 August para San Timoteo, 15 August for Our Lady of the Rosary and the last sunday of august for La Regalina.
  • Usual duration: The programmes usually extend several days around the main date, with previous events, the main day and complementary activities.
  • Usual places: Luarca, the surroundings of the port and festive spaces of the town; in Cadavedo, the field and hermitage of La Regalina.
  • Associated traditions: pilgrimage, religious events, music, popular gatherings, fishing atmosphere in Luarca, processions and street activities according to each year's programme.
  • Who participates: City Council, festival commissions, associations, neighbourhood, clubs, families and visitors.
